How to choose a nearby printing shop

When you need a document reproduced quickly, start by checking the basics: turnaround times, file types accepted, and whether the shop offers both color and black-and-white output. Look for clear guidance on submitting files (upload links, email, or in-store options) and confirm the paper options available for your use case, such print out near me as plain paper, thicker stock, or specialty finishes. If you’re printing a presentation, verify whether they handle resizing and scaling correctly so margins don’t crop important text. For signage or flyers, ask about recommended paper weight and whether double-sided printing is supported.

Quick checklist for ordering print services

Before you place an order, prepare your content for smoother results. Use a standard page size, include bleed if you’re producing flyers or brochures, and ensure images are high resolution so the print looks crisp. If your file is a PDF, double-check that fonts are embedded and that links or layers won’t cause missing elements. Finally, confirm collection or delivery details, and keep a backup copy of the final file in case adjustments are needed.

Best options for common document types

For everyday handouts and reports, black-and-white printing is usually the most cost-effective, while color is ideal for charts, branding, and proposals. If you need professional-looking documents, consider double-sided output and stapling or binding where available. For posters and large-format pieces, enquire about paper thickness and whether the shop can print at the size you require without distortion. For event materials such as flyers or leaflets, ask about folding options and whether the shop can handle trimming accurately. If you need last-minute copies, prioritize shops that provide a straightforward workflow from file to output.
